OLLI at Sierra College
Fall Semester 2025

In honor of America's 250th Anniversary

America's First Ladies

"The FLOTUS Series"

Back By Popular Demand!

---------------------------------

​​Term 1 - Washington to Monroe - Sept

Term 2 - Adams 2 to Tyler - Oct-Nov

In person - Rocklin Campus

and Via Zoom

---------------------------------

Term 1: The first four First Ladies, Martha Washington, Abigail Adams, Dolly Madison, and Elizabeth Monroe, lived fascinating lives and played indispensable roles in their husbands' illustrious political careers. We’ll explore the lives and contributions of these women, America's Founding Mothers. How did they live? How did they influence their President husbands? Some historians say that without the assistance of their wives, none of their husbands would have found themselves elected to the Presidency.

​

Term 2: Very different from the Founding Mothers, the Second Generation of First Ladies, Louisa Adams, Rachel Jackson, Leticia and Julia Tyler, were also very different from one another. One expanded the role of First Lady, another became an influential ghost, and a third turned rebel and joined the Confederacy. Come discover their fascinating stories.

Talks Available for
Clubs & Groups

The Invention of the First Lady

---------------------------------

The first three First Ladies, Martha, Abigail, and Dolley, have vastly different personalities and brought very different strengths to the position. But between them, they created the role of First Lady out of thin air. In fact, not one of their husbands would have ended up in the White House had they not had these women as their partners.
